Understanding Agricultural Production and Management Science and Education:

Agricultural Production and Management Science and Education is a multidisciplinary field that merges the principles of agricultural science, management, and education. This discipline focuses on imparting knowledge and skills related to efficient and sustainable agricultural practices, while also equipping students with pedagogical methods to become effective educators and trainers in the agricultural sector.

Admission Requirements for Nigerian Universities:

For those aspiring to study Agricultural Production and Management Science and Education in Nigerian universities, several common admission requirements should be kept in mind:

  1. O’Level Results: Prospective students usually need a minimum of five credit passes in relevant subjects, including Mathematics, English Language, Biology or Agricultural Science, Chemistry, and any other science subject.
  2. UTME (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ination): Students must participate in the UTME organized by JAMB. They should select Agricultural Production and Management Science and Education or a closely related course as their preferred program.
  3. JAMB Subject Combination: The recommended JAMB subject combination for this field often includes Biology or Agricultural Science, Chemistry, Mathematics or Physics, and any other relevant science or social science subject.
  4. Post-UTME Screening: Universities typically conduct a post-UTME screening exercise that involves written tests and/or interviews. Performance in these screenings contributes to the overall evaluation of the candidate.

Admission Requirements for Nigerian Polytechnics:

Aspiring students aiming for Agricultural Production and Management Science and Education in Nigerian polytechnics should be aware of the following admission criteria:

  1. O’Level Results: Similar to universities, candidates usually require five credit passes in relevant subjects, including Mathematics, English Language, Biology or Agricultural Science, Chemistry, and one other science or social science subject.
  2. UTME: Participation in the UTME is a prerequisite, with Agricultural Production and Management Science and Education or related courses selected as the preferred program.
  3. JAMB Subject Combination: The JAMB subject combination for polytechnics often includes Biology or Agricultural Science, Chemistry, Mathematics or Physics, and any other relevant science or social science subject.
  4. Post-UTME Screening: Polytechnics may also conduct post-UTME screenings involving written tests or interviews to assess candidates’ suitability for the program.

Admission Requirements for Colleges of Education:

Students aspiring to study Agricultural Production and Management Science and Education in Nigerian Colleges of Education should consider the following admission criteria:

  1. O’Level Results: Candidates are generally required to possess five credit passes in relevant subjects, including Mathematics, English Language, Biology or Agricultural Science, Chemistry, and one other science or social science subject.
  2. UTME: Participation in the UTME is usually necessary, with Agricultural Production and Management Science and Education or related courses selected as the preferred program.
  3. JAMB Subject Combination: The JAMB subject combination for Colleges of Education often includes Biology or Agricultural Science, Chemistry, and any other relevant science or social science subject.
  4. Post-UTME Screening: Similar to universities and polytechnics, Colleges of Education may also conduct post-UTME screenings involving written tests or interviews.
